Highfield Court is a unique student accommodation located in Englefield Green, just a stone's throw from Royal Holloway University. This residence hall, steeped in history and charm, offers a blend of comfort and community that many students find appealing. With its various room configurations, including single en-suite and shared options, it caters to a diverse student body, making it an ideal choice for both undergraduates and postgraduates. The overall atmosphere at Highfield Court is often described as friendly and welcoming, with many students noting the strong sense of community that develops over time. This is particularly beneficial for first-year students who may be new to university life and looking to make connections. The accommodation has received positive feedback for its spacious and comfortable rooms, which are well-equipped for student living. Many reviews highlight the quality of the beds and the reliability of the WiFi, both of which are crucial for balancing study and leisure activities. The communal kitchen and dining areas are also frequently mentioned as well-equipped and conducive to socializing, allowing students to bond over meals and shared experiences. The location of Highfield Court is another significant advantage. Situated near the Royal Holloway campus, students appreciate the easy access to classes, libraries, and university facilities. The transport links are convenient, with Egham Station just a short walk away, providing direct connections to London and other areas. This makes it easy for students to explore the wider region while still enjoying the tranquility of campus life. In terms of facilities, students have noted that Highfield Court is well-maintained and equipped with essential amenities. The laundry facilities are functional, and the building has a clean and tidy appearance, contributing to a comfortable living environment. The management team appears to be proactive and responsive, addressing any maintenance issues quickly and efficiently, which adds to the overall positive living experience. While Highfield Court is highly rated for its value and facilities, it is important to note that it may not be the cheapest accommodation option available. However, many students feel that the quality of life and sense of community justify the costs. The atmosphere is often described as relaxed and respectful, making it a suitable choice for those who appreciate a quieter living environment while still having access to social opportunities. The communal areas are designed to foster interaction among residents, and many students have shared fond memories of the friendships they've formed during their time here. On the downside, some reviews suggest that while the social life can be vibrant, it can also vary from night to night, with some evenings feeling quieter than others. Additionally, while most students find the space comfortable, there are mentions of it occasionally feeling crowded, particularly during peak times. This could be a consideration for those who prefer a more private or less bustling environment. 💡 Things to Know

  • Highfield Court is self-catered, so students should plan to prepare their own meals.
  • The accommodation offers both en-suite and shared room options to suit different preferences.
  • Communal areas are designed to encourage socializing, which can enhance the student experience.
  • Maintenance issues are typically resolved quickly, ensuring a hassle-free living environment.
